Battery Type: 1x AA battery, not included.Movement type: Radio Controlled Movement.The shaft length for this movement is 12 mm. Second cap - when you don't use a second hand, this will be put on the second shaft.Center nut - to tighten the movement to your clock.Washer - to put between the center nut and the clock.Rubber ring - to put between the movement and the clock to equally spread the pressure when you tighten the movement.This will make it able to hang your clock. Metal hanger - (optional) to put between the movement and the rubber ring.Our movements are delivered with all the parts for an easy and complete assembly. The movement is working with the DCF signal, what means that it is working for most European countries like The Netherlands, Germany, France, Spain, Italy etc (CET Time zone). So you never have to worry anymore about summer or winter time, the clock will adjust itself. This radio controlled movement will adjust itself automatically to the correct time. ![]()
